The Bakwena thrashing grain-sorghum by thrumping it with donkeys. The central figure is a Trust inmate who was permitted to keep the large land before the Trust took over farm Clermont. In 1944 the amount of grain-sorghum was estimated at several thousands of bags (approximately 8000+)"
